The role contributes to the success of Liebherr-Great Britain Ltd and Liebherr Construction Equipment-Ireland Ltd by carrying out effective maintenance and repair work on equipment on customer premises or on site. Ensuring both quality standards and timelines for repair are optimised at all times leading to increased customer confidence and repeat business, whilst ensuring outstanding customer service at all times within the Company’s key result areas:

Business Performance, Customer Focus, People and Teamwork, Leadership. Your responsibilities as a Field Service Engineer

To undertake diagnostic, service, repair, recovery, technical and operational instruction on Liebherr crane products on behalf of Liebherr-Great Britain Ltd (LGB) and Liebherr Construction Equipment-Ireland Ltd (LIR). To undertake similar work on non-Liebherr products from time to time as necessary as approved and appropriate. To focus, as a priority, on the Company’s mobile crane customers and also to become familiar with and support customers with other product types. To participate in the early stages with the effective processing of warranty claims. To identify opportunities to develop revenue work with contacted customers and reduce exposure to costs and risks. To investigate specific customer problems on a project-by-project basis, providing technical reports as may be requested. To undertake additional tasks, training and projects as may be reasonably requested by the company from time to time. To work additional hours as reasonably required to undertake the described duties and to be available to work a rota based out-of-hours customer support. To undertake all duties predominately in the UK and Republic of Ireland but also be prepared to travel outside this territory as required from time to time. To be successful in the Field Service Engineer role

Satisfactory completion of a recognised apprenticeship in a related industry to NVQ level 3 or equivalent. Relevant product or industry experience. Able to demonstrate through experience in a similar industry application of skills and knowledge gained. Offer
